Meine /etc/resolv.conf:
Code: Alles auswählen
# added by NetworkManager
nameserver 192.168.0.254
Wie änder ich die Config von dnsmasq nun so ab, dass die Subnetze von eth0 und wlan0 unterschiedlich sind?
Code: Alles auswählen
# added by NetworkManager
nameserver 192.168.0.254
Code: Alles auswählen
route -n
Code: Alles auswählen
dhcp-option=option:router,yy.yy.yy.yy
dhcp-option=option:dns-server,xx.xx.xx.xx
Einfach wieder wie früher einrichten?Bisher war das kein Problem, da die IP des Routers 192.168.178.1 lautete.
Nun lautet sie jedoch 192.168.0.254.
Code: Alles auswählen
Kernel-IP-Routentabelle
Ziel Router Genmask Flags Metric Ref Use Iface
0.0.0.0 192.168.0.254 0.0.0.0 UG 1024 0 0 wlan0
169.254.0.0 0.0.0.0 255.255.0.0 U 1000 0 0 eth0
192.168.0.0 0.0.0.0 255.255.255.0 U 0 0 0 eth0
192.168.0.0 0.0.0.0 255.255.255.0 U 0 0 0 wlan0
Code: Alles auswählen
interface=eth0
dhcp-range=192.168.0.10,192.168.0.128,infinite
Geht nicht, da ich mich nun in einem fremden Netzwerk befinde.Einfach wieder wie früher einrichten?
Routingkonflikt auf Deinem Rechner.Code: Alles auswählen
192.168.0.0 0.0.0.0 255.255.255.0 U 0 0 0 eth0 192.168.0.0 0.0.0.0 255.255.255.0 U 0 0 0 wlan0
Code: Alles auswählen
0.0.0.0 192.168.0.254 0.0.0.0 UG 1024 0 0 wlan0
Da sehe ich das Problem nicht.Die IP von eth0 ist weiterhin 192.168.0.1. Wie kann ich das ändern?
Das ist eine Möglichkeit. Früher gab es halt zwei getrennte Netze und somit war der "dnsmasq-Rechner" quasi schon ein Router.rendegast hat geschrieben: Richte für eth0 und damit die per eth0 angeschlossenen Clients ein anderes Netz ein,